What Does Error i10 Mean?
The Dishlex dishwasher error code i10 indicates a water fill issue, often caused by insufficient water reaching the appliance during the fill cycle. Symptoms include the cycle starting and then stopping early, insufficient water filling, or the machine pumping water out if the water level isn't sensed within a specific time frame. Common causes include low water supply due to a partially closed tap, a kinked or clogged inlet hose, or a malfunctioning water inlet valve. Addressing these issues can help restore normal operation.

How to Fix Error i10
DIY Fix Check basic water supply conditions
- Ensure the dishwasher’s water tap is fully open
- Check household water pressure (e.g., run a tap and confirm normal flow)
- Verify no other appliance is causing low water pressure
DIY Fix Inspect and clean inlet hose and filters
- Turn off water and power to the dishwasher
- Check the inlet hose for kinks or bends
- Remove and clean inlet hose filters (at tap and hose ends)
Technician Only Test and replace water inlet valve if necessary
- Disconnect power and water
- Access the water inlet valve
- Test valve operation and electrical resistance
- Replace valve if malfunctioning
